La principessa non così piccola

Questa serie segue le avventure di una giovane ragazza mentre passa dall'infanzia alla prima adolescenza. Le storie si concentrano sulle sue scoperte del mondo, sull'apprendimento della responsabilità e sulla gestione delle nuove sfide che derivano dal crescere. Esplora temi di famiglia, amicizia e scoperta di sé con umorismo ed empatia. Questi racconti accattivanti sono perfetti per costruire la fiducia nella lettura nei giovani lettori.
